How do microgrids impact the economy?

The deployment of microgrids has a positive impact on the local workforce and the creation of jobs. Skillsets to operate and maintain a microgrid may lead to further job opportunities and the availability of energy, in turn, spurs economic growth. Microgrids can be designed and operated to maximize the use of renewable resources.

Why do we need a microgrid?

With a higher number of distributed energy resources (DERs), there are certain voltage and power characteristics that must be maintained. Microgrids offer the ability to regulate these quantities as well as reduce or offset the amount of load presented to the supplying utility.

Why do Governments Invest in microgrids?

Government- or ratepayer-funded investments in these microgrids are common due to the social values associated with maintaining critical services during power outages. Report: How many jobs will microgrids produce?

Data from a microgrid jobs report finds that every $1 million invested in US microgrids creates 3.4 skilled jobs and $500,000 in additional economic benefits.
